Churchill In Croydon

Winston Churchill (1874 - 1965) gives his famous v-sign as he opens the new headquarters of 615 (County of Surrey) Squadron of the RAAF (Royal Auxiliary Air Force) at Croydon, 1948. (Photo by Central Press/Hulton Archive/Getty Images)
